Topic 1. Goodbye Cash, Goodbye Privacy
There has been quite a push to get rid of cash these past few years driven by governments, retailers, banks and other societal pressures. Cash provides something digital payments do not normally provide, the ability to make offline & anonymous payments. Should we be so keen to abandon cash entirely?
Are we okay with tech companies and banks knowing everything we purchase, where we spend, who we spend with then selling that data on or using it to target us with advertisements and content? Are we okay with governments implementing large scale warrantless #FinancialSurveillance operations on the populace? Are we okay with our spending and saving data being used to score, rate, rank us in everything from job applications to dating profiles?
